Angry 98 caddy deville starter stuck

Every now and then when I crank the car the starter will stick. If it cranks you can here it still turning I turn the key to off to try and stop it and nothing it just keeps on going had to unhook the battery to kill it. Only does this every now and then. I took the steering wheel off and took the key ignition out I didn't see anything out of the ordinary. Was wondering if this has ever happened to anyone on here before any help and advice is greatly appreciated.

I looked through the engine compartment and there is no starter relay mounted anywhere in there I traced the hot wire from the battery and it goes straight under the intake manifold so I will be removing that to access the starter and will go from there. But just wanted to let people know on the 98 deville there is no starter relay mounted in the engine compartment.
